1 Case Study 567 Collins Street: The Client's view of BIM Investa Office Nathan Lyon Agenda Who is Investa? What do we want from BIM? Our roadmap Where from and Where to Design and Construction overview Facilities Management The importance of knowing what we re getting Was it a success? What were/are the challenges? 1
2 Who is Investa? > Commercial Office Specialists > 43 commercial office buildings Australia wide > Over 1100 tenants > Over 1,000,000m2 of commercial office space > Manages assets worth over $8.7billion ICPF, IOF, LAT > Portfolio & Asset Management > Commercial Development 3 ASSET LOCATIONS Brisbane 8 Sydney 24 Canberra 1 Melbourne 6 Perth 3 4 2

Coca Cola Place (The ARK) Investa successfully delivered an award winning A-Grade 28,500m2 office building Completed May 2010 The first full BIM commercial office project in Australia What happened post completion? 7 Where are we now? The Facilities Management industry Barcodes and traditional CAFM systems Perceived as a little mysterious Investa Viewed as a key support function Traditional drawing management Version control issues Non standardised information storage Microsoft Sharepoint/Windows Explorer 8 4

6 Design Overview Traditional design process had been employed Architects model was in 3D, others were doing whatever worked for them Standard coordination issues, but what s the difference! Architects model wasn t really being used by other disciplines 12 Construction Overview BIM started 7 months after construction had begun Internal BIM manager was appointed Culture change exercise for the builder Educate and enable key individuals - Then let s worry about COBie - Then tenant fit-outs - Then tie it all together - Hopefully 13 6
7 Construction Coming up to speed 22nd July 2013 BIM Kickoff 23rd July 2013 First Combined Model 26th July 2013 Draft BIM Plan Issued 29th July 2013 Navisworks Training 31st July 2013 Mech. Services Models Combined 14th Aug 2013 First Coordination Meeting 16th Aug 2013 First Shop Detailed Model 20th Aug 2013 Offshore Modelling Begins 22 nd Aug 2013 Safety in Design Review 30 th Aug 2013 First models from offshore 14 BIM informed Risk Management 15 7

11 Ok, now how are we going to use it..? Ran a software RFP with AECOM November 2014 Define how we wanted to interact with the model and data: -Functional requirements: Vendor System, Usability, Aspirations -Existing system interoperability -Hardware requirements: Needed to fit corporate IT rather than a specialist environment This was a challenge for the software vendors, as well as Investa Turned into a bespoke software procurement process that challenged the business (quite different to a business as usual activity) 26 Was it a Success? Well, yes. Kind of We gained a clear understanding of our own needs - What is it that we re trying to achieve? And; - What do we need to be able to deliver it? Debunked a number of misnomers of lifecycle BIM - There is no silver bullet We have a working knowledge of friction points within the D&C phases Developed a solid understanding of BIM within the AEC Industry 27 11
12 What were, and are the Challenges? Attempting to establish a BIM process after the project had commenced Aligning expectations understanding each others perspectives Multi formatted authoring files CADduct, Revit, CAD As-Built issue lead times A continual learning process/culture change for our business: - Investa Design and Construction BIM standards - Tenant model management living, breathing models with multiple authors, security of published models - Ongoing base building model management On-costs? - Completely new way of interacting with tenants and R&M contractors - Sub-Contractor/Design Engineer BIM capability 28 Questions?
